The annual salary statistics of first-line supervisors of farming, fishing, and forestry workers in Poughkeepsie-Newburgh-Middletown, New York is shown in Table 1. The wage information of first-line supervisors of farming, fishing, and forestry workers in Poughkeepsie-Newburgh-Middletown is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].
|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
|---|---|
| 10th Percentile Wage | $49,550 |
| 25th Percentile Wage | $51,930 |
| 50th Percentile Wage | $55,880 |
| 75th Percentile Wage | $59,830 |
| 90th Percentile Wage | $66,940 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for first-line supervisors of farming, fishing, and forestry workers in Poughkeepsie-Newburgh-Middletown, New York in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$66,940.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$55,880.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$49,550.
